Mattituck, NY's wildfire risk, in USFS's own numbers
Mattituck's 3,622 buildings earn a 40th-percentile wildfire-risk score nationally under USFS's model — close to the middle of USFS's national wildfire-risk range. (Source: USFS's Wildfire Risk to Communities methodology.)
Separately from the risk score above, Mattituck's burn probability — fire likelihood with no building count factored in — sits at the 39th percentile nationally.
Mattituck's building exposure, zone by zone
49.2% of Mattituck's 3,622 buildings sit in USFS's Direct exposure zone, roughly 1,781 structures close enough to burnable vegetation for flame contact, not just embers — 25.1% fall in the Indirect, ember-only zone and 25.8% are Minimal.
Where Mattituck ranks
Mattituck's 84th-percentile standing inside New York outpaces its 40th national percentile — this is a hotter spot than most of its own state, even though the state as a whole runs cooler nationally. Among the 31,521 US communities USFS scores, Mattituck ranks 18,941 for wildfire risk (1 is highest) and 4,630 by building count (1 is largest). Within New York alone, it ranks 203 of 1,289 places by risk. See the full county-by-county picture for New York on its state page.
